Multiple ports with different baud rate over a single serdes

1. A transmitter apparatus for a source device, the transmitter apparatus comprising:
a plurality of ports for data to be transmitted to a destination device, with each port being associated with a transmission data rate; and
processing circuitry configured to:
obtain data to be transmitted to the destination device via the plurality of ports,
multiplex the data to be transmitted to the destination device according to a weighted round-robin scheme to generate a multiplexed data stream,
wherein the weights of the weighted round-robin scheme are determined based on the transmission data rate of the respective port,
wherein the weights of the weighted round-robin scheme are proportional to the transmission data rates of the plurality of ports, and
transmit the multiplexed data stream directly to the destination device via a single serializer-deserializer.
